NCT ID: NCT06060171 Recruiting - Clinical trials for Valvular Heart Disease

Pathological Changes in the Cardiovascular System in Valvular Heart Disease

PATH-VHD
Start date: August 1, 2021
Phase:
Study type: Observational

An observational cohort study of patients recruited presenting with valvular heart disease. The specialized investigations will focus on myocardial remodelling and scar formation/regression and extracardiac micro- and macro-vascular sequelae of valvular heart disease (VHD). The aim is to investigate the natural history of VHD and its ensuing cardiac and extracardiac end organ effects, the impact of existing interventions and the long-term outcome. We hope to establish the underlying causative aetiology of known associated conditions (e.g. vascular dementia) and to determine if extracardiac changes may serve as early biomarkers of prognosis in VHD. Participants will attend for two visits at Barts Heart Centre or Chenies Mews Imaging Centre and will undergo a panel of tests including cross-sectional cardiac imaging, point-of-care microvascular assessment and blood tests. Patient outcome will be assessed by data linkage to hospital episode statistic (HES) data and ONS data (via NHS spine). We aim to identify determinants that will help to improve patient selection and timing of valve intervention based on advanced clinical, blood and/or imaging biomarkers.

NCT ID: NCT06058793 Recruiting - Clinical trials for Liposarcoma, Dedifferentiated

Brightline-4: A Study to Test How Well Brigimadlin is Tolerated by People With a Type of Cancer Called Dedifferentiated Liposarcoma

Start date: December 12, 2023
Phase: Phase 3
Study type: Interventional

This study is open to adults with a type of cancer called dedifferentiated liposarcoma (DDLPS). They can join the study if their tumours are positive for MDM2. The purpose of this study is to find out whether a medicine called brigimadlin (BI 907828) is tolerated by and helps people with DDLPS. Brigimadlin is a so-called MDM2 inhibitor that is being developed to treat cancer. Participants take brigimadlin as a tablet once every 3 weeks. Participants may continue to take brigimadlin as long as they benefit from treatment and can tolerate it. They visit the study site regularly. At the study site, doctors regularly check participants' health and take note of any unwanted effects. The doctors also regularly check tumour size.

NCT ID: NCT06057220 Not yet recruiting - Clinical trials for Oesophagogastric Cancer

IMaC - Immune Pathways in Oesophagogastric Cancer

IMaC
Start date: October 2023
Phase:
Study type: Observational

The number of cases of oesophagogastric cancer is increasing every year. Currently, only 39% of patients with oesophageal cancer can have potentially curative treatment by the time they are diagnosed. This is because it typically presents late, and it is only when patients start to develop symptoms of advanced disease such as difficulty swallowing and weight loss, that they seek medical attention. There are approximately 9300 new cases of oesophageal cancer in the UK each year and at 17%, it has the 5th poorest 5-year survival of all cancers in the UK. It is diagnosed by carrying out a camera test called a gastroscopy which allows a biopsy of the cancer to be taken. This is an invasive procedure, and unlike for other types of cancer, such as bowel cancer, there is no test to risk-stratify patients at an earlier stage. Risk-stratification enables patients more likely to develop oesophagogastric cancer to be identified, which allows them to have more focused follow-up. This can potentially enable cancer to be diagnosed earlier, before the disease becomes more advanced, allowing patients to have potentially curative treatment. Scientific research has identified that the healthy bacteria in the oesophagus and stomach changes as oesophagogastric cancer develops. The investigators want to see if similar changes can be identified in the healthy bacteria in the mouth which could be indicative of cancer developing in the oesophagus or stomach. The investigators then hope to use this information to develop a non-invasive risk-stratification tool that can be used to diagnose oesophagogastric cancer earlier and thereby enable more patients to be cured.

NCT ID: NCT06056609 Recruiting - Anxiety Clinical Trials

Mother and Baby Yoga Study - Early Postnatal Yoga and Mental Health

MABY
Start date: August 15, 2022
Phase: N/A
Study type: Interventional

Investigating the influence of an early postnatal mother and baby yoga programme on maternal mental health and relationship with baby: a randomised feasibility study. It is thought postnatal mother and baby yoga decreases levels of depression and anxiety and increases subjective experience of maternal-infant bonding. This project will provide the necessary data to determine whether a regular programme would be beneficial to mothers. The research study is an eight-week online programme incorporating gentle postnatal mother and baby yoga involving women 6-12 weeks following birth (at recruitment/study commencement). The outcome measures include mothers' feelings about their mental health and bond with their baby.

NCT ID: NCT06055725 Recruiting - Clinical trials for Spasticity as Sequela of Stroke

A Study to Estimate How Often Post-stroke Spasticity Occurs and to Provide a Standard Guideline on the Best Way to Monitor Its Development

EPITOME
Start date: November 1, 2023
Phase:
Study type: Observational

This study will monitor patients during the first year following their stroke. Stroke is a very serious condition where there is a sudden interruption of blood flow in the brain. The main aim of the study will be to find out how many of those who experience their first-ever stroke then go on to develop spasticity that would benefit from treatment with medication. Spasticity is a common post-stroke condition that causes stiff or ridged muscles. The results of this study will provide a standard guideline on the best way to monitor the development of post-stroke spasticity.
